Æthelred the Unready: Life, Reign, and Reputation


Listen Later

Æthelred II, famously dubbed the Unready, governed England during a volatile period marked by the resurgence of Viking invasions and internal political strife. These sources detail his long and fractured reign, which included a brief period of exile in Normandy following the conquest by Swein Forkbeard. While traditional history often paints him as an incompetent leader, modern scholars highlight his administrative achievements, such as sophisticated legal codes and a highly regulated coinage system. The text also explores his complex family life, his efforts to placate invaders through monetary tributes, and the eventual collapse of English resistance under his son, Edmund Ironside. Ultimately, the records present a nuanced view of a monarch who struggled to maintain national unity against overwhelming external pressure.
